Cottage by the Sea helps more children have opportunities for fun and inspiration. We are an Australian children’s charity that does not rely on government funding.

Founded in 1890 in Queenscliff, Victoria as the Ministering Children’s League by Annie Hitchcock and Elizabeth Calder, the vision has always been that every child deserves a happy and healthy childhood. Our rich history continues to this day.

Located only a stone’s throw from the beach, we aim to empower young people by providing them with inspiration, fun and opportunity through our four tailored programs – Take A Break, REEF, Mentor and National. The young people who attend are chosen with the help of schools and welfare agencies from all around Australia.

With more than 1,500 children attending each year, it is a big task running the charity. Cottage by the Sea operates with a Board of ManagementstaffBranches, a team of amazing volunteers and our passionate Patron, Rebecca Maddern.

Cottage by the Sea is enormously proud to be an organisation that does not rely on government funding. This independence goes hand-in-hand with autonomy. That Cottage by the Sea is funded by private sources, also serves to demonstrate how beloved the Cottage is within our community.  

The guiding principle adopted by Cottage by the Sea is that it exists independently of government funding. It does not rely on or seek government funding support. That said, on limited occasions, Cottage has received Government support. In 2018, Cottage by the Sea was grateful to receive partial federal government capital funding of $1.5M for a very special project: the major refurbishment of the building in 2019/2020. This funding went hand in hand with the funding received from private sources to enable Cottage by the Sea to look after more children in an improved facility for decades to come.
